New to ELAR Instruction? Grades 3-8
Share
If you are new to teaching Reading & Writing in grades 3-8 this session is for you. Where do I start? Let's meet to address questions, concerns and plan instruction for your first semester. Participants will examine standards, state assessments and instructional/organizational strategies for the intermediate reading & writing classroom.
